**Action Item 7: Hermetic build migration for Trellick**

Hey, as agreed in the postmortem, we're moving the Trellick pipeline off the shared build hosts and onto Cairnforge, the hermetic build system. The root cause last week was a stale system library leaking into release artifacts, and hermetic builds make that class of bug impossible. Owner is the Pellwyn infra squad, target is the next release train. Release manager just needs to flip the pipeline flag once staging is green. The migration ships with the following tuning constants.

tuning constants:
BUDGETS = {
    "druath": 240,
    "lamwyn": 180,
    "silael": 275,
}

**Vendor note: Inkmill markdown pipeline**

Rendering for Parchway docs is outsourced to Inkmill under an annual contract, renewing each March. They handle sanitization and PDF export; we own the upload queue. SLA: 4-hour response on rendering failures. Escalate only after two failed retries. Their support desk is reachable at the address below.

billing contact of hahaf-baguf = zorael.tammir.jorius@sivrelhq.internal

Quarterly Planning Note — Insurance Renewal. Department heads should note that our combined property and liability cover with Merrowfield Assurance expires at the end of Q3. Broker soundings suggest a premium uplift of roughly twelve percent, driven by last year's warehouse claim at Kellbridge. We will test two alternative carriers while keeping Merrowfield as the baseline. Please submit updated asset registers by week six. The strategic rationale is set out in the note below.

confidential, yahip-hagug: Gorixax Logistics plans to lower the Ulaael list price by 26.6 percent in October. The pricing group signed off on a budget of $199.9 million for Project Holix. The renewal with Kasdorox Systems closes at $137.5 million a year, 8.2 percent above the last contract. Project Lamion slips by a full year because of the audit delay.

# Seat-map renderer env — Stagefront Theatre build
# Hey release crew: this config drives the Orchestra Hall seat-map renderer
# for the Pellbright booking flow. Keep the tile cache URL pointed at staging
# until the balcony layout migration lands — mixing them garbles the mezzanine
# rows something awful. Everything here is safe to commit except the render
# service token, which the renderer needs to fetch venue layouts. That token
# goes on the very next line.

sealed setting: ARCHIVE_KEY3=8d0